ORDER

Mr.S.Manivannan and Mr.S.Ramesh Kumar, the petitioners in W.P.No.1884 of 2018, were appointed as Clerk and Junior Clerk on 19.7.99 and 18.4.98 respectively adhering to the roster point in the existing vacant posts and both are presently working in K.1776 Sriram Cooperative Housing Construction Society Limited and they are continuing as such as on date. Similarly, Mr.P.Matheswaran and Mr.K.N.Ravichandran, the petitioners in W.P.No.1885 of 2018, were also appointed as Clerk on 15.5.2000 and 7.6.2000 respectively in the SLM/HSG 49, Tiruchengode Taluk Cooperative Housing Society Limited and they are continuing as such as on date.

2. Learned counsel for the petitioners submitted that since the Government in consultation with the Registrars have issued

proceedings for extension of certain benefits, the Registrar of Cooperative Societies, in his proceedings bearing Rc.No.92088/2008/SF3 dated 21.08.2008 addressing to all the Additional Registrars, issued a direction for extension of time scale of pay to the irregular employees without conferment of any legal status appending a specific clause that the granting or extending of time scale of pay would not entitle them to claim for regularisation and finally directions were issued to enter into a settlement either under Section 12(3) or Section 18

(1) of the Industrial Disputes Act, 1947. Thereafter, the Registrar of Coooperative Societies, in his proceedings bearing Na.Ka.No.57232/2013/Thi.Ka.Ku.Pa dated 15.8.2013, granted the benefit of time scale of pay, medical reimbursement, dearness allowance, encashment of leave, medical leave, earned leave, retirement benefits on par with the regular employees, except for regularisation. In view thereof, the petitioners gave their representations and the same are pending. Under similar circumstances, when W.P.Nos.27475 & 27476 of 2017 were filed by Mr.V.Saravanakumar and Mr.A.Sundararajan seeking a direction to consider their case, as per the proceedings of the Registrar of Coooperative Societies made in Rc.No.92088/2008/SF3 dated 21.08.2008, this Court, by order dated 26.10.2017, considering the limited prayer, directed the Registrar of Coooperative Societies (Housing), Nandanam, Chennai to consider their representation. Therefore, a similar order may be passed, he pleaded.

3. The learned Special Government Pleader, taking notice on behalf of the respondent, submitted that when a similar order has already been passed by this Court, he sought time to consider the pending representations of the petitioners, on merit.

4. Since this Court has already passed a similar order in W.P.Nos.27475 & 27476 of 2017 on 26.10.2017, the respondent is hereby directed to consider the representations of the petitioners on merit and pass appropriate orders in accordance with law, on the basis of the proceedings of the Registrar of Cooperative Society dated 21.8.2008 and 15.8.2013, within a period of four we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. The writ petitions are disposed of accordingly. No costs. Sd/- Assistant Registrar(co) //True Copy// Sub Assistant Registrar
